Monero is the leading cryptocurrency focused on private and censorship-resistant transactions.
A private, decentralized cryptocurrency that keeps your finances confidential and secure.
The sender, receiver, and amount of every single transaction are hidden through the use of three important technologies: Stealth Addresses, Ring Signatures, and RingCT.
XMRUSD performed well in the past two days.
Any daily close above $180 confirms further bullishness.
XMRUSD gained more than 8% in the past two days. The pair holds well above the short-term (21 and 55 EMA) and long-term moving average. It hit a high of $162.97 and is currently trading around $161.88.
The bullish invalidation can happen if the pair closes below $140. On the lower side, the near-term support is $150. Any break below target $140/$134/$115. significant downtrend if it breaks $100.
The immediate resistance stands at around $180. Any breach above confirms bullish continuation. A jump to $200/$216 is possible. A surge past $216 will take it to $229/$250.
It is good to buy on dips around $155 with SL around $140 for TP of $200.
